This is a guide for all doctors - GPs and hospital doctors alike, on the law and how it affects them. It is a practical guide, and it approaches its subject with the use of realistic scenarios throughout. These relevant case histories are used as a basis for discussion and explanation of the legal implications of a doctors actions. Guidelines for best practice are given. This is not a theoretical book. Its aim is to give the reader an understanding of the way in which they may be legally challenged as health professionals, and how to minimize this risk. This book examines the processes and factors shaping the development of homeland security policies in the European Union (EU),



within the wider context of European integration.The EU functions in a complex security environment, with perceived security threats from Islamist terrorists, migration and border security issues, and environmental problems. In order to deal with these, the EU has undertaken a number of actions, including the adoption of the European Security Strategy in 2003, the Information Management Strategy of 2009, and the Internal Security Strategy of 2010.
